Lezers zoals jij steunen MUO. Wanneer u een aankoop doet via links op onze site, kunnen we een aangesloten commissie verdienen. Lees verder.

Adminer is een webgebaseerde tool waarmee u meerdere databasesystemen vanaf een centrale locatie kunt beheren. De tool is gebruiksvriendelijk, lichtgewicht en eersteklas prestaties met een nette gebruikersinterface.

De Adminer-databasemanager is beschikbaar op alle Linux-distributies. U kunt het eenvoudig via de terminal op Ubuntu installeren en configureren en via elke browser toegang krijgen tot de webinterface. U kunt databasebewerkingen rechtstreeks vanuit het Adminer-dashboard uitvoeren en eenvoudig meerdere databases beheren.

Hier leest u hoe u Adminer op Ubuntu installeert en instelt.

Wat is beheerder?

Alternatief voor phpMyAdmin, Adminer is een open-source tool voor het beheren van meerdere databases vanaf een gecentraliseerde locatie. De tool biedt ondersteuning voor MariaDB, MySQL, SQLite, Oracle, PostgreSQL, MongoDB en Elasticsearch.

Adminer heeft een betere beveiliging dan phpMyAdmin en is lichter in gewicht. Het wordt geleverd met een schone interface die het gemakkelijk maakt om te gebruiken en te leren. U kunt er toegang toe krijgen via de webinterface door het IP-adres op te geven van de machine waarop de Adminer-instantie wordt uitgevoerd.

instagram viewer

Hoe beheerder op Ubuntu te installeren

Hier zijn de stappen om Adminer te installeren Op Ubuntu gebaseerde distributies:

Stap 1: Update en upgrade Ubuntu

Voordat u naar de Adminer-installatie gaat, moet u uw systeem bijwerken en upgraden, zodat u geen problemen ondervindt met nieuwe installaties. Open de terminal op uw Ubuntu-machine door op te drukken Ctrl+Alt+T en voer de update- en upgrade-opdrachten uit.

sudo geschikt update && sudo geschikt upgrade

Stap 2: Installeer Apache op Ubuntu

Nadat u de systeempakketten hebt bijgewerkt en geüpgraded, is de volgende taak het installeren van Apache. Doe dit door de volgende opdracht uit te voeren:

sudo geschikt installeren apache2

Zodra Apache succesvol is geïnstalleerd, schakel de service in met behulp van het hulpprogramma systemctl:

sudo systemctl inschakelen --nu apache2

Zorg er ook voor dat Apache goed werkt zonder fouten op de achtergrond te veroorzaken.

sudo systemctl-status apache2 --no-pager -l

Dit vertelt dat Apache actief is en goed werkt op Ubuntu.

Stap 3: Installeer PHP op Ubuntu

Aangezien Adminer in PHP is geschreven, moet u PHP en de essentiële extensies installeren. Voer het volgende uit om het te installeren:

sudo geschikt installeren php php-curl libapache2-mod-php php-cli php-mysql php-gd php-fpm

Nadat je PHP en zijn extensies met succes hebt geïnstalleerd, laad je Apache opnieuw met:

systemctl herlaad apache2

Stap 4: Installeer MariaDB op Ubuntu

Na het installeren van PHP heeft u een database op uw systeem nodig die u kunt beheren met Adminer. U kunt elke database installeren, zoals MySQL, MariaDB, PostgreSQL, MongoDB, SimpleDB, enz.

Aangezien MariaDB meestal wordt gebruikt in veel op PHP gebaseerde applicaties, laten we het op Ubuntu installeren.

sudo geschikt installeren mariadb-server

Nadat de database is geïnstalleerd, schakelt u deze in:

sudo systemctl inschakelen --nu mariadb

Controleer of de database goed werkt door de status te controleren:

sudo systemctl-status mariadb

Dit vertelt dat MariaDB actief is en goed werkt op Ubuntu.

Nadat je MariaDB hebt geïnstalleerd, moet je het ook beveiligen met een script waarmee je een root kunt instellen wachtwoord voor MariaDB, verwijder anonieme gebruikers, sta root-login op afstand niet toe en verwijder de test databank. Voer het volgende uit om het script uit te voeren:

sudo mysql_secure_installation

Stap 5: stel het beheerderswachtwoord in voor de beheerder

Om de database met Adminer te beheren, hebt u toegang nodig tot de root-databasegebruiker. Daarvoor heb je een root-wachtwoord nodig waarmee je alle databases via Adminer kunt beheren.

Om het wachtwoord in te stellen, opent u eerst de MySQL-opdrachtregel:

sudo mysql

Voer het volgende uit om het root-wachtwoord in te stellen:

SETWACHTWOORDVOOR'wortel'@'localhost' = WACHTWOORD("mijn wachtwoord");

Vervang "mijn wachtwoord" met het wachtwoord dat u wilt behouden voor de rootgebruiker.

Voer het volgende uit om het wachtwoord bij te werken:

SPOELENVOORRECHTEN;

Voer het volgende uit om de MariaDB-opdrachtregel te verlaten:

Uitgang;

Stap 6: Installeer Adminer op Ubuntu

U kunt Adminer op Ubuntu installeren met behulp van de APT-pakketbeheerder:

sudo geschikt installeren beheerder

Schakel na installatie php-fpm in:

sudo a2enconf php*-fpm

Voer het volgende uit om het Apache-configuratiebestand voor Adminer in te schakelen:

sudo a2enconf beheerder

Laad Apache nu opnieuw om de zojuist aangebrachte wijzigingen bij te werken:

systemctl herlaad apache2

Zodra je Apache opnieuw hebt geladen, herstart je het met:

sudo systemctl herstart apache2

Stap 7: Toegang tot de Adminer-webinterface

Nu alle benodigde installaties voor Adminer zijn uitgevoerd, kunt u de applicatie openen via de webinterface en beginnen met het beheren van uw database.

Om toegang te krijgen tot Adminer, opent u een browser en geeft u het IP-adres op van de machine waarop Adminer wordt uitgevoerd.

Als u Adminer op het lokale systeem gebruikt, gebruikt u dit adres:

http://127.0.0.1/adminer

Als u Adminer echter op een externe computer uitvoert, geeft u het IP-adres van de machine op om toegang te krijgen tot Adminer, zoals dit:

http://server-ip-address/adminer

U ziet de volgende inlogpagina in uw browser nadat u het webadres naar Adminer hebt geleid:

Om u aan te melden bij Adminer, voert u root in als gebruikersnaam en geeft u het wachtwoord op dat u in stap 5 hebt ingesteld. U hoeft de databasenaam niet op te geven, aangezien de beheerder toegang heeft tot alle beschikbare databases, dus laat het Databank doos leeg. Klik na het invoeren van alle gevraagde informatie op Log in.

Zodra u toegang heeft, vindt u het volgende dashboard. Vanaf hier heeft u toegang tot alle beschikbare databases om ze te beheren. U kunt hier ook een database aanmaken of verwijderen.

Zoals u kunt zien, is de Adminer-interface eenvoudig, niet erg bevolkt en daarom gemakkelijk te beheren.

Hoe Adminer van Ubuntu te verwijderen

Als u Adminer niet langer nodig heeft om uw databases te beheren, kunt u deze eenvoudig van uw systeem verwijderen. Voer het volgende uit om Adminer van Ubuntu te verwijderen:

sudo apt automatisch verwijderen --verwijder beheerder

Als u ook MariaDB, Apache en PHP van uw systeem wilt verwijderen, is dat ook mogelijk met behulp van standaard Linux-commando's.

Om dat te doen, moet u deze services eerst stoppen en vervolgens verwijderen. Voer het volgende uit om Apache en MariaDB te stoppen:

sudo systeemctl stop apache2 mariadb

Verwijder nu MariaDB, PHP en Apache met:

sudo apt automatisch verwijderen --purge mariadb-server php* apache2

Beheer al uw databases efficiënt vanuit een gecentraliseerde beheerdersinterface

Met Adminer kunt u al uw databases beheren vanuit één enkele webinterface. U kunt meerdere databasebewerkingen uitvoeren op Adminer, zoals het maken of verwijderen van een database, tabellen bewerken, door tabelrijen bladeren/invoegen/bewerken, kolommen sorteren, DB-objecten bewerken en nog veel meer meer.

Er is ook geen limiet aan het beheer van databases in Adminer. phpMyAdmin, aan de andere kant, heeft alleen ondersteuning voor MariaDB en MySQL, waardoor Adminer het favoriete databasebeheersysteem is. U kunt ervoor kiezen om met phpMyAdmin te gaan, maar u moet MariaDB of MySQL op uw computer installeren.